Thank you for your contribution! Sashiko AI review found 1 potential issue(s) to consider:
- [Medium] The use of `$$(shell ...)` with unescaped variables like `$(CC)` inside a block evaluated by `$(eval)` causes a double-expansion bug that corrupts compiler flags containing `$`.
--
commit 8e0d941d5a7133e71fe2afde9b8f70d691de8879
Author: Ian Rogers <irogers@google.com>
tools build: Integrate libdebuginfod into test-all fast path
This commit integrates libdebuginfod into the test-all fast path. It also
updates feature_check_code to short-circuit the feature check and avoid
a sub-make fork if a feature was already pre-detected.
> diff --git a/tools/build/Makefile.feature b/tools/build/Makefile.feature
> index 2f192d3bf61b9..064c75dd9914b 100644
> --- a/tools/build/Makefile.feature
> +++ b/tools/build/Makefile.feature
> @@ -8,7 +8,9 @@ endif
>
> feature_check = $(eval $(feature_check_code))
> define feature_check_code
> - feature-$(1) := $(shell $(MAKE) OUTPUT=$(OUTPUT_FEATURES) CC="$(CC)" CXX="$(CXX)" CFLAGS="$(EXTRA_CFLAGS) $(FEATURE_CHECK_CFLAGS-$(1))" CXXFLAGS="$(EXTRA_CXXFLAGS) $(FEATURE_CHECK_CXXFLAGS-$(1))" LDFLAGS="$(LDFLAGS) $(FEATURE_CHECK_LDFLAGS-$(1))" -C $(feature_dir) $(OUTPUT_FEATURES)test-$1.bin >/dev/null 2>/dev/null && echo 1 || echo 0)
> + ifeq ($(feature-$(1)),)
> + feature-$(1) := $$(shell $(MAKE) OUTPUT=$(OUTPUT_FEATURES) CC="$(CC)" CXX="$(CXX)" CFLAGS="$(EXTRA_CFLAGS) $(FEATURE_CHECK_CFLAGS-$(1))" CXXFLAGS="$(EXTRA_CXXFLAGS) $(FEATURE_CHECK_CXXFLAGS-$(1))" LDFLAGS="$(LDFLAGS) $(FEATURE_CHECK_LDFLAGS-$(1))" -C $(feature_dir) $(OUTPUT_FEATURES)test-$1.bin >/dev/null 2>/dev/null && echo 1 || echo 0)
Does leaving variables like $(CC), $(EXTRA_CFLAGS), and $(LDFLAGS) unescaped
inside the $$(shell ...) block cause a double-expansion issue?
When eval parses the assignment, these variables are expanded in the first
pass, embedding their literal values into the string.
During the second pass, when the shell function is evaluated, Make scans the
embedded string again. If any compiler or linker flags contain a literal $
(such as -Wl,-rpath=$$ORIGIN), they will be incorrectly expanded during this
second pass (for example, replacing $O with the value of the output directory
variable O), corrupting the flags.
> + endif
> endef
